About Marcos Toebe

Marcos Toebe is a scholar working on Plant Science, Agronomy and Crop Science, Soil Science, Forestry and Ecology, having authored 124 papers that have together received 1.0k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Genetics and Plant Breeding (61 papers), Growth and nutrition in plants (32 papers), Crop Yield and Soil Fertility (31 papers), Banana Cultivation and Research (23 papers), Leaf Properties and Growth Measurement (20 papers), Soil Management and Crop Yield (15 papers), Agricultural and Food Sciences (13 papers) and Soybean genetics and cultivation (10 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Forestry (88 citations), Plant Science (808 citations), Agronomy and Crop Science (198 citations), Soil Science (141 citations) and Horticulture (7 citations). Marcos Toebe has collaborated with scholars based in Brazil, United States and Vietnam. Frequent co-authors include Alberto Cargnelutti Filho, Cláudia Burin, Bruna Mendonça Alves, Sidinei José Lopes, Lindolfo Storck, Alessandro Dal’Cól Lúcio, Gustavo Oliveira dos Santos, Vanderlei Both, Auri Brackmann and Leandro Souza da Silva. Their work appears in journals such as Pesquisa Agropecuária Brasileira, Bragantia, Ciência Rural, European Journal of Agronomy and Ciência Agronômica/Revista ciência agronômica.
